
On Children’s Day 2011, the children of Queren village, Mori Kazak Autonomous County, Xinjiang moved to the brand-new Pigeon Hope Kindergarten built with the aid of Pigeon (Shanghai) Co., Ltd. It is reported that the expanded area of the new kindergarten is 720 square meters. There are 165 children altogether, including 65 at the preschool, 44 in the top class, 30 in the middle class, and 26 in the bottom class. The Pigeon Hope Kindergarten at Mori County, Xinjiang is the third built with contributions from Pigeon, following the schools in Sichuan and Qinghai.
